SEARCH
NEW RPMS
DIRECTORIES
ABOUT
FAQ
VARIOUS
BLOG

 
 
Changelog for chocolate-doom-3.1.0-1.3.x86_64.rpm :

* Tue Sep 10 2024 Jan Engelhardt - Update to release 3.1.0
* WAD file autoloading was added
* Music pack configuration was simplified. Copy .flac/.ogg music files into a directory and they will be automatically detected by filename and so used.
* Music packs can now be used with OPL as a fallback, and music pack config files can have any name ending in `.cfg`.
* MP3 music packs are now supported.
* Network synchronization now uses a PID controller by default, which makes games more smooth and more stable, especially for Internet play.
* UDP hole punching is now used to make servers behind NAT gateways automatically accessible to the Internet.
* Allow simultaneous PC speaker emulation and OPL emulation.
* The 0 and 5 keys on the number pad can now be bound independently of any other keyboard key.
* With aspect ratio correction disabled, the game can scale to any arbitrary size and remove all black borders in full screen mode.
* It is now possible to use -response to load response files.
* Mouse movement is no longer read when the game window is inactive.
* The Freedoom single-player IWAD files are now officially supported, as recent versions changed all levels to be vanilla compatible.
* Add native support for the FluidSynth MIDI synthesizer.
* Add improved gamepad support via the SDL_GameController interface. This includes support for analog triggers, modern dual-stick default bindings, descriptive button names for common controller types, and configurable dead zones for stick axes.
* The -display parameter was added to specify the display number on which to show the screen.- Delete 0001-build-use-python3-exclusively.patch (merged)
* Wed Mar 29 2023 Jan Engelhardt - Switch from packageand() to modern rpm conditionals- Avoid conflict with crispy-doom manpages
* Sat Jun 26 2021 Jan Engelhardt - Add 0001-build-use-python3-exclusively.patch so we can build without python2.
* Wed Jul 01 2020 Jan Engelhardt - Update to release 3.0.1
* Fixed a bug where a client in a networked game can cause a stack-based buffer overflow on the server [CVE-2020-14983, boo#1173595]
* Sat Jun 06 2020 Jan Engelhardt - Set CFLAGS+=-fcommon.
* Wed Nov 14 2018 Jan Engelhardt - Update description.
* Wed Jan 10 2018 jengelhAATTinai.de- Update to new upstream release 3.0.0 (2017-12-30)
* Update to SDL2. All scaling is now done in hardware.
* It is possible to toggle fullscreen with Alt-Enter.
* On multimonitor setups, the game will remember the used screen.
* A new parameter, -savedir allows users to specify a directory from which to load and save games.
* The GOG install of Doom 3: BFG Edition is now detected.
* The CD audio option for music playback has been removed; the CD playback API has been removed from SDL 2.0.
* Strife\'s voices.wad is now correctly loaded before PWADs.
* Tue Jul 04 2017 jengelhAATTinai.de- Update to new upstream release 2.3.0 (2016-12-29)
* Pitch-shifting from early versions of Doom, Heretic, and Hexen is now supported.
* Aspect ratio-corrected 1600×1200 PNGs are now written.
* OPL emulation is more accurate.
* DMX bugs with GUS cards are now better emulated.
* Checksum calculations are fixed on big endian systems, allowing multiplayer games to be played in mixed little/big-endian environments.
* The vanilla limit of 4046 lumps per WAD is now enforced.
* Solidsegs overflow is emulated like in vanilla.
* It is now possible to start multiplayer Chex Quest games.
* Versions 1.666, 1.7, and 1.8 are emulated.
* An issue was fixed where the game crashed while killing the Wraithverge in 64-bit builds.- Drop chdoom-date.diff (no longer needed), drop chdoom-sdlsound.diff (merged upstream).
* Wed Nov 16 2016 jengelhAATTinai.de- Add chdoom-sdlsound.diff to resolve build error with new libsamplerate
* Sat Nov 07 2015 jengelhAATTinai.de- Update to new upstream release 2.2.1
* The Hexen four level demo IWAD is now supported.
* The Doom reload hack has been added back.
* OPL music playback has been improved in a number of ways to match the behavior of Vanilla Doom\'s DMX library much more closely. OPL3 playback is also now supported.- Drop chdoom-nonvoid.diff (included upstream), drop chdoom-prng.diff (PRNG impl. was switched)
 
ICM